Titanic is one of the greatest maritime legends in history. When she set sail in April 1912 she was the largest heaviest most expensive and most luxurious manmade moving object on the planet. This fascinating five part series brings the drama technological accomplishment and social history of the Edwardian manufacturing industry back to life. Titanic: The Mission sees a team of modern engineers - Yewande Akinola Luke Perry Brendan Walker and Dave Wilkes - use hundred year old methods to recreate iconic sections of the ship including the mighty hull the luxurious interiors... and the sixteen ton anchor. And in so doing they explore the industries and workers who built the ship magnificent. [show more]
